The new EID tagging system being brought in for sheep will likely mean that the price for RFID chips will drop across the range. This means that our Dog, Horse and Cat identifiers will come down in price because of the high number of RFID chips being ordered by Irish farmers.
I've put together a table of some of the current prices quoted by tag suppliers for the farmers market as I called around.
QuickTag
Slaughter 18c
EID €1.30
Mulinahone
Slaughter 18c
EID €1.30
Applicator €22
EliteTags
Slaughter 15c
EID €1.19
Applicator €6.37
Agrihealth
Slaughter 34
EID 1.30
Ritchey Tag
Slaughter 25c
EID €1.33
At the moment it seems EliteTags ( http://elitetagsireland.com ) are out in front. We should hope for prices to continually drop and we'll soon see our dog tags costing as much as it would to have "Fido" printed on the front!!!
